Roles and Responsibilities:

The Staff Design Civil Engineer is responsible for planning, designing, and overseeing a variety of civil engineering projects, including but not limited to airfields, bridges, buildings, channels, pipelines, roads, sewage systems, and water supply infrastructure.

Essential Functions:

• Develop and review civil engineering designs, plans, and specifications for infrastructure projects including roads, utilities, drainage systems, and site development.

• Conduct site assessments, feasibility studies, and technical analyses to support planning and execution of new designs, renovations, and repairs.

• Evaluate existing infrastructure and provide recommendations for upgrades, modifications, or repairs.

• Prepare engineering reports, cost estimates, project updates, and technical documentation for supervisors and clients.

• Draft clear and concise technical documentation to communicate design intent and project objectives to stakeholders.

• Review architect-engineer submissions, technical evaluations, and preliminary design reports, providing constructive feedback.

• Apply strong engineering judgment and problem-solving skills throughout all phases of project development.

• Ensure all designs comply with applicable codes, standards, and environmental regulations.

• Manage workload independently, take ownership of assigned tasks, and consistently meet project deadlines.

• Contribute to quality assurance by reviewing internal and external designs for consistency and alignment with project goals.

• Take initiative to define project requirements when objectives are not clearly established.

• Review shop drawings and submittals to ensure conformance with design intent and specifications.

• Support construction administration by responding to RFIs, evaluating change orders, and participating in project meetings.

•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to understand project requirements and deliver effective engineering solutions.

• Communicate effectively with clients, stakeholders, and internal teams.

• Perform other duties as assigned.
